Top 5 Questions Every Tenant Should Ask Their Landlord






Are you renting in Nigeria? Equip yourself with these essential questions to ensure a smooth tenancy experience.

Inclusions in Rent: Are there additional costs, such as service charges, or is everything bundled into the rent?

Repair Responsibilities: If something breaks or needs maintenance, who is responsible—the landlord or the tenant?

Lease Renewal and Rent Increase: How often might the rent be reviewed, and by how much can it increase?

Security Deposit: How much is it, and under what conditions is it refundable?

Property Modifications: Can the property be modified or redecorated? If yes, to what extent?

 

The Future of Real Estate: Trends to Watch

Nigeria's real estate market, ever reflective of its evolving society, is undergoing significant transformations. Here are some trends to watch:

Sustainable Housing: As global awareness of environmental issues grows, Nigeria isn't left behind. Sustainable, eco-friendly housing solutions are gradually gaining traction.

Tech in Real Estate: Virtual property tours, blockchain in property documentation, and AI-driven property suggestions are just the tip of the iceberg.

Urban Luxury Living: With cities like Lagos and Abuja becoming sprawling metropolises, the demand for luxury urban estates is rising.
